Overview
Spanning over 4,840 square kilometers of pristine savannah woodland, Mole National Park stands as Ghana's premier wildlife destination. The park boasts an impressive array of wildlife including elephants, buffalo, antelopes, warthogs, and over 300 bird species. Its diverse ecosystems range from gallery forests to open grasslands, creating a perfect habitat for both predators and prey. Visitors can enjoy guided walking safaris, vehicle tours, and immersive nature experiences that showcase West Africa's rich biodiversity.
